Job summary

Soft Tox in Pontiac, MI is seeking a Forensic Toxicologist to perform high-complexity analytical testing on biological specimens to identify drugs, poisons, and alcohol, supporting death investigations and ensuring accurate, evidence-based conclusions. You will analyze findings, interpret data, and provide toxicology results used to determine cause and manner of death.

Collaboration with pathologists, investigators, and law enforcement is essential, with opportunities to provide expert testimony

Forensic Toxicology

Join our team in a highly specialized scientific role where your expertise directly supports death investigations and the pursuit of accurate, evidence-based answers. In this position, you’ll perform complex toxicological testing on biological specimens to identify and interpret the presence of drugs, poisons, and alcohol. Your work will provide critical scientific information to pathologists, death investigators, and law enforcement agencies and may play an important role in legal proceedings.

What You’ll Do
  • Perform high-complexity analytical testing on biological specimens to identify, quantify, and interpret drugs, poisons, alcohol, and other substances.
  • Analyze and interpret laboratory findings to provide accurate, scientifically supported results.
  • Provide critical toxicology data used in determining the cause and manner of death.
  • Collaborate with pathologists, death investigators, law enforcement, and other professionals throughout the investigative process.
  • Prepare and communicate scientific findings clearly and accurately.
  • Provide expert testimony regarding laboratory procedures, testing, and findings in legal proceedings.
  • Utilize current County and department-specific software to document results and complete assignments.

Experience, Training, Knowledge, Skills & Abilities Required Minimum Qualifications
  • 1. a. Possess a Bachelor's degree from an accredited college or university with a major in toxicology, pharmacology, biochemistry, analytical chemistry, biology, forensic science or closely related field of study.
  • 1. b. Have had two (2) years of full-time analytical experience in forensic toxicology;
  • OR
  • 2. a. Possess a Master’s degree from an accredited college or university in toxicology, pharmacology, biochemistry, analytical chemistry, biology, forensic science or a closely related field of study.
  • 2. b. Have had at least one (1) year of full-time analytical experience in forensic toxicology, testing toxic agents;
  • OR
  • 3. Possess a Ph.D. from an accredited college or university in toxicology, pharmacology, biochemistry, analytical chemistry, biology, forensic science or a closely related field of study.
Special Requirements
  • Submit to annual tuberculin skin test or chest X-ray, at County expense.
